It depends on which pair you have I found, I have 5 pairs, original ethanol, vapor, kutan, stasis and tragic. Each of them are a little different.
The ethanol are very thin, a couple washs and holes will start appearing, keep in mind Rogan is built to wear fast. Hand wash and hang dry if you dont want them to fall apart.
The stasis is a basic unwashed indigo, the indigo is really deep, I haven't washed mine yet and I have had them for over 6 months, they are still maintaining the indigo color.
The ethanol, kutan , and tragic I have washed several times in the machine and dryer and they get even nicer, they wear out nicely and in parts you can begin to see the redlining show through the tears. All get softer and nicer with wear.
